A high-speed rail development company based in Birmingham is seeking a Commercial Manager to oversee commercial activities within delivery teams. The role requires expertise in managing high-value contracts, supporting commercial strategies, and liaising with supply chain partners.

Candidates should possess strong negotiation skills and experience in managing commercial management teams for infrastructure projects. This position offers an opportunity to contribute to a vital national project while promoting a culture of equality and inclusion within the workforce.
